Madison Twp., MI – Madison School District investigated vandalism, which included a threatening statement, in one of their high school bathrooms Thursday. Superintendent Nick Steinmetz issued a statement to Madison families, saying that the matter was investigated and that there was determined to be “…no imminent threat to the safety of the school community.”
